Two GC2 6 volt batteries fit in the space of 2 GP24 batteries and each weighs about 60-65 pounds. They are significantly easier to handle into/out of a travel trailer battery

If you invest in a quality 12V deep cycle battery that isn’t designed for marine engines (like AGM, Gel, or Lithium), it can be just as durable as a 6V battery. Weight is another big difference. Two 71-pound 6V batteries with 225Ah are much easier to handle than one massive 114-pound 12V battery with 200Ah.

Weight of 6V Batteries 6V batteries are typically larger and heavier than 12V batteries, but because they are often used in pairs, the combined weight of two 6V batteries can add significant weight to your RV. Each 6V battery weighs around 60 to 70 pounds on average, meaning a two-battery system could weigh over 120 pounds.
Many campers believe 6V (golf cart) batteries last longer because they’re built with thicker internal plates and designed to handle more charging cycles than 12V batteries. This is partly true, for some 12V deep cycle batteries, but not all of them.
